If a photo’s price a thousand words, then how way more precious is video? That’s the idea of video advertising and marketing, a forward-going through advertising and marketing strategy that integrates partaking video into your advertising campaigns. Video marketing can be utilized for every little thing from constructing buyer rapport, to selling your model, services or merchandise.


Moreover, video marketing can serve as a medium to present how-to’s, promote customer testimonials, dwell-stream occasions and deliver viral (entertaining) content material. On the floor, the how of video advertising is fairly simple: Your brand creates movies that, in some way or one other, promote your company, drive gross sales, raise awareness of your products or services, or interact your prospects.


In observe, it’s a little bit extra complicated. Like many of your advertising efforts, video advertising and marketing is information driven, so you’ll need to monitor varied metrics and monitor buyer engagement. Allocate sources. You’re going to have to designate some finances for video - in any case, first rate gear, good enhancing software, and a video advertising guru (or, higher, group) - in addition to time to create it. Inform your stories. Storytelling has by no means been as vital as it's in video, so get brainstorming: What stories would you like to tell?


How will you inform them? Interact. It’s not sufficient to simply tell your tales; it's essential to engage your viewers when you achieve this. How will you make your tales fascinating? What's going to hook your viewers? Keep it quick. There’s no set length for marketing movies (though there are recommendations), but the general rule is that shorter is best. Be ruthless together with your editing. Minimize, reduce, reduce out all the things extraneous. Attention spans are short, so make the better of what you get.

The benefits of video advertising and marketing are many. Let’s begin with the simply quantifiable: statistics, numbers, and information - oh my!


Video helps you join with your viewers. As we speak, so much of a company’s advertising and marketing efforts are designed to assist build trust. Video is the bridge that links what you say to who you really are, allowing prospects to peer behind the curtain and get to know your model. Video is an Search engine optimisation gold mine, serving to construct backlinks to your site, boosting likes and shares (which may effect search rankings), and driving site visitors to your site. And let’s not overlook that YouTube is owned by Google, so you'll want to post your videos to YT and tag, tag, tag with key phrases/key phrases! Videos boost data retention.


In case your prospects hear something only, they’re more likely to retain about 10% of that data three days later; by contrast, if what they hear is accompanied by relevant imagery, they’ll retain a mean 65% of that data three days later. In 2017, video content will account for an estimated 74% of all online traffic.
